vue-组件
2016-10-26 11:49:20 0 举报
AI智能生成
Vue.js 是一款用于构建用户界面的渐进式框架。与其他大型框架不同的是,Vue被设计为可以自底向上逐层应用。Vue 的核心库只关注视图层,不仅易于上手,还便于与第三方库或既有项目整合。另一方面,当与现代化的工具链以及各种支持类库结合使用时,Vue 也完全能够为复杂的单页应用提供驱动。 在 Vue 中,组件是构建可复用用户界面的基本构建块。组件化使你的代码更加模块化、可维护和可测试。你可以在一个 Vue 组件中定义数据和方法,然后在多个地方使用这个组件。这样可以避免重复编写相同的代码,并且可以更好地组织你的代码结构。
作者其他创作
大纲/内容
什么是组件?
组件可以拓展HTML元素,封装可重用的代码,
组件是自定义元素
使用插槽slot来分发内容
使用组件
注册
局部注册
通过某组件的components对象
注册语法糖
组件选项问题
这里说了为什么data要写成函数
父子组件通信
父-》子:数据
props
子-》父:事件
父组件用on监听事件
子组件用emit来触发事件
.async这个属性,可以让子组件改变了某个值后父组件也跟着改变
0 条评论
下一页